summaryrefslogtreecommitdiff
authorharlekin <harlekin>2002-09-04 13:05:47 (UTC)
committer harlekin <harlekin>2002-09-04 13:05:47 (UTC)
commit41a5097ec65c57935aa4425e7e969be9ca591fba (patch) (unidiff)
tree0988e9b474e7ac50068e10f9c4ec3d85e4a75ef8
parent04da91b7a4451366cb005c1e2bb4f649283cc7f9 (diff)
downloadopie-41a5097ec65c57935aa4425e7e969be9ca591fba.zip
opie-41a5097ec65c57935aa4425e7e969be9ca591fba.tar.gz
opie-41a5097ec65c57935aa4425e7e969be9ca591fba.tar.bz2
test
Diffstat (more/less context) (ignore whitespace changes)
-rw-r--r--noncore/multimedia/opieplayer2/audiowidget.cpp5
1 files changed, 4 insertions, 1 deletions
diff --git a/noncore/multimedia/opieplayer2/audiowidget.cpp b/noncore/multimedia/opieplayer2/audiowidget.cpp
index a718826..040e965 100644
--- a/noncore/multimedia/opieplayer2/audiowidget.cpp
+++ b/noncore/multimedia/opieplayer2/audiowidget.cpp
@@ -483,110 +483,113 @@ void AudioWidget::mouseMoveEvent( QMouseEvent *event ) {
483} 483}
484 484
485 485
486void AudioWidget::mousePressEvent( QMouseEvent *event ) { 486void AudioWidget::mousePressEvent( QMouseEvent *event ) {
487 mouseMoveEvent( event ); 487 mouseMoveEvent( event );
488} 488}
489 489
490 490
491void AudioWidget::mouseReleaseEvent( QMouseEvent *event ) { 491void AudioWidget::mouseReleaseEvent( QMouseEvent *event ) {
492 mouseMoveEvent( event ); 492 mouseMoveEvent( event );
493} 493}
494 494
495 495
496void AudioWidget::showEvent( QShowEvent* ) { 496void AudioWidget::showEvent( QShowEvent* ) {
497 QMouseEvent event( QEvent::MouseMove, QPoint( 0, 0 ), 0, 0 ); 497 QMouseEvent event( QEvent::MouseMove, QPoint( 0, 0 ), 0, 0 );
498 mouseMoveEvent( &event ); 498 mouseMoveEvent( &event );
499} 499}
500 500
501 501
502void AudioWidget::closeEvent( QCloseEvent* ) { 502void AudioWidget::closeEvent( QCloseEvent* ) {
503 mediaPlayerState->setList(); 503 mediaPlayerState->setList();
504} 504}
505 505
506 506
507void AudioWidget::paintEvent( QPaintEvent * pe) { 507void AudioWidget::paintEvent( QPaintEvent * pe) {
508 if ( !pe->erased() ) { 508 if ( !pe->erased() ) {
509 // Combine with background and double buffer 509 // Combine with background and double buffer
510 QPixmap pix( pe->rect().size() ); 510 QPixmap pix( pe->rect().size() );
511 QPainter p( &pix ); 511 QPainter p( &pix );
512 p.translate( -pe->rect().topLeft().x(), -pe->rect().topLeft().y() ); 512 p.translate( -pe->rect().topLeft().x(), -pe->rect().topLeft().y() );
513 p.drawTiledPixmap( pe->rect(), *pixBg, pe->rect().topLeft() ); 513 p.drawTiledPixmap( pe->rect(), *pixBg, pe->rect().topLeft() );
514 for ( int i = 0; i < numButtons; i++ ) 514 for ( int i = 0; i < numButtons; i++ )
515 paintButton( &p, i ); 515 paintButton( &p, i );
516 QPainter p2( this ); 516 QPainter p2( this );
517 p2.drawPixmap( pe->rect().topLeft(), pix ); 517 p2.drawPixmap( pe->rect().topLeft(), pix );
518 } else { 518 } else {
519 QPainter p( this ); 519 QPainter p( this );
520 for ( int i = 0; i < numButtons; i++ ) 520 for ( int i = 0; i < numButtons; i++ )
521 paintButton( &p, i ); 521 paintButton( &p, i );
522 } 522 }
523} 523}
524 524
525void AudioWidget::keyReleaseEvent( QKeyEvent *e) { 525void AudioWidget::keyReleaseEvent( QKeyEvent *e) {
526 switch ( e->key() ) { 526 switch ( e->key() ) {
527 ////////////////////////////// Zaurus keys 527 ////////////////////////////// Zaurus keys
528 case Key_Home: 528 case Key_Home:
529 break; 529 break;
530 case Key_F9: //activity 530 case Key_F9: //activity
531 hide(); 531 hide();
532 // qDebug("Audio F9"); 532 // qDebug("Audio F9");
533 break; 533 break;
534 case Key_F10: //contacts 534 case Key_F10: //contacts
535 break; 535 break;
536 case Key_F11: //menu 536 case Key_F11: //menu
537 mediaPlayerState->toggleBlank(); 537 mediaPlayerState->toggleBlank();
538 break; 538 break;
539 case Key_F12: //home 539 case Key_F12: //home
540 break; 540 break;
541 case Key_F13: //mail 541 case Key_F13: //mail
542 mediaPlayerState->toggleBlank(); 542 mediaPlayerState->toggleBlank();
543 break; 543 break;
544 case Key_Space: { 544 case Key_Space: {
545 if(mediaPlayerState->playing()) { 545 if(mediaPlayerState->playing()) {
546 // toggleButton(1); 546 // toggleButton(1);
547 mediaPlayerState->setPlaying(FALSE); 547 mediaPlayerState->setPlaying(FALSE);
548 // toggleButton(1); 548 // toggleButton(1);
549 } else { 549 } else {
550 // toggleButton(0); 550 // toggleButton(0);
551 mediaPlayerState->setPlaying(TRUE); 551 mediaPlayerState->setPlaying(TRUE);
552 // toggleButton(0); 552 // toggleButton(0);
553 } 553 }
554 } 554 }
555 break; 555 break;
556 case Key_Down: 556 case Key_Down:
557 // toggleButton(6); 557 // toggleButton(6);
558 emit lessClicked(); 558 emit lessClicked();
559 emit lessReleased(); 559 emit lessReleased();
560 // toggleButton(6); 560 // toggleButton(6);
561 break; 561 break;
562 case Key_Up: 562 case Key_Up:
563 // toggleButton(5); 563 // toggleButton(5);
564 emit moreClicked(); 564 emit moreClicked();
565 emit moreReleased(); 565 emit moreReleased();
566 // toggleButton(5); 566 // toggleButton(5);
567 break; 567 break;
568 case Key_Right: 568 case Key_Right:
569 // toggleButton(3); 569 // toggleButton(3);
570 mediaPlayerState->setNext(); 570 mediaPlayerState->setNext();
571 // toggleButton(3); 571 // toggleButton(3);
572 break; 572 break;
573 case Key_Left: 573 case Key_Left:
574 // toggleButton(4); 574 // toggleButton(4);
575 mediaPlayerState->setPrev(); 575 mediaPlayerState->setPrev();
576 // toggleButton(4); 576 // toggleButton(4);
577 break; 577 break;
578 case Key_Escape: { 578 case Key_Escape: {
579#if defined(QT_QWS_IPAQ) 579/*
580 * author pleas tell me where the i come from .-)
581 #if defined(QT_QWS_IPAQ)
580 if( mediaPlayerState->isPaused ) { 582 if( mediaPlayerState->isPaused ) {
581 setToggleButton( i, FALSE ); 583 setToggleButton( i, FALSE );
582 mediaPlayerState->setPaused( FALSE ); 584 mediaPlayerState->setPaused( FALSE );
583 } else if( !mediaPlayerState->isPaused ) { 585 } else if( !mediaPlayerState->isPaused ) {
584 setToggleButton( i, TRUE ); 586 setToggleButton( i, TRUE );
585 mediaPlayerState->setPaused( TRUE ); 587 mediaPlayerState->setPaused( TRUE );
586 } 588 }
587#endif 589#endif
590*/
588 } 591 }
589 break; 592 break;
590 593
591 }; 594 };
592} 595}